欣慰大地

文章
7
资源
0
加入时间
3年0月20天

react生命周期构造函数react生命周期构造函数

react生命周期构造函数1.componentWillMount在完成首次渲染之前调用,此时仍可以修改组件的state。2.render必选的方法,创建虚拟DOM,该方法具有特殊的规则:只能通过this.props和this.state访问数据可以返回null、false或任何React组件只能出现一个顶级组件(不能返回数组)不能改变组件的状态不能修改DOM的输出3.componentDidMo...

JS中一道关于函数柯里化的面试题

问题:实现一个函数,使得其运算结果可以满足如下预期结果:add(1)(2) // 3add(1, 2, 3)(10) // 16add(1)(2)(3)(4)(5) // 15解答:该题目实际上是利用了JS中函数的一种高级用法--函数柯里化,即将参数多次传入,采用参数缓存的技巧进行函数的apply循环调用,最终计算出结果。代码如下:function add () { var args = Array.prototype.slice.call(arguments);//缓存